“He'll play enough first base to retain first-base eligibility, and he'll give you close to 30 home runs, 100 RBI and a .300 average. ”

 

“Players with 100 RBI are tough to find at this point in the draft. Butler has consistently hit .300 and should give you at least 20 HR.”

 

“Butler finally put together that 30 HR potential to go along with his .300+ batting average in 2012. Now that he did it, we can expect him to repeat those numbers as they do not make a lot of hitters as big as Billy these days. The Royals are looking for a big season, Butler will be there to clean it up.”
